Real estate companies are often judged by the most visible elements of the business – their projects. At Taylor & Mathis, we measure a project's success in many ways: It functions well for the people who work in it; it is a financial success for its owners/investors; it receives community acceptance or industry recognition; its appearance pleases people. By these benchmarks we've developed many successful projects, and we take great pride in them. Our projects are not, however, the yardstick for measuring our success.
The true measures of Taylor & Mathis' success are the business philosophy, the relationships and the people we have developed. We believe that the keys to good business are integrity, dependability and customer service. We expect our people to respond quickly and professionally to tenant and client needs. We expect them to meet their commitments to tenants and clients, and exhort them to deliver more than they promise.
These principles are a way of life at Taylor & Mathis and have come to embody our corporate culture. They are why tenants who choose to stay and grow with us account for more than 60% of our project expansion. They are why we enjoy long-term relationships with institutional owners. They are why our clients are our best references.
